William Briton

John Bale places his death in 1356 at Grimsby.

Briton's works, enumerated by Bale, are principally concerned with dialectics.

He is remembered, however, for his 'Vocabularium Bibliæ,' a treatise explanatory of obscure words in the Scriptures.

These, with supplemental specimens, were printed by Angelo Maria Bandini.
